Câu hỏi được gắn thẻ «methods»

5
Truyền đối tượng hai lần cho cùng một phương thức hoặc hợp nhất với giao diện kết hợp?
Tôi có một phương pháp tạo tệp dữ liệu sau khi nói chuyện với bảng kỹ thuật số: CreateDataFile(IFileAccess boardFileAccess, IMeasurer boardMeasurer) Ở đây boardFileAccessvà boardMeasurerlà cùng một thể hiện của một Boardđối tượng thực hiện cả hai IFileAccessvà IMeasurer. IMeasurerđược sử dụng trong trường hợp này cho một phương …



2
Thiết kế: Phương thức đối tượng và phương thức của lớp riêng biệt lấy đối tượng làm tham số?
Ví dụ, tốt hơn là làm: Pdf pdf = new Pdf(); pdf.Print(); hoặc là: Pdf pdf = new Pdf(); PdfPrinter printer = new PdfPrinter(); printer.Print(pdf); Một vi dụ khac: Country m = new Country("Mexico"); double ratio = m.GetDebtToGDPRatio(); hoặc là: Country m = new Country("Mexico"); Country us = new Country("US"); …



5
Sự khác nhau giữa tin nhắn và phương thức?
Trong Mục tiêu C, bạn có khái niệm gửi tin nhắn đến các đối tượng khác, và, điều này rất giống với cách gọi phương thức trong các ngôn ngữ như C # và Java. Nhưng chính xác những khác biệt tinh tế là gì? Làm thế nào tôi nên …
13 methods 




5
Làm thế nào để khái niệm về một lớp thay đổi khi truyền dữ liệu đến hàm tạo thay vì các tham số của phương thức?
Hãy nói rằng chúng tôi đang làm một trình phân tích cú pháp. Một cách thực hiện có thể là: public sealed class Parser1 { public string Parse(string text) { ... } } Hoặc chúng ta có thể chuyển văn bản cho hàm tạo thay thế: public sealed class Parser2 …

3
Trong Java 8, việc sử dụng các biểu thức tham chiếu phương thức hoặc các phương thức trả về việc triển khai giao diện chức năng có tốt hơn về mặt phong cách không?
Java 8 đã thêm khái niệm về các giao diện chức năng , cũng như nhiều phương thức mới được thiết kế để có các giao diện chức năng. Thể hiện của các giao diện này có thể được tạo ra một cách ngắn gọn bằng cách sử dụng các …


6
Thiết kế các phương thức liên quan đến cơ sở dữ liệu, cái nào tốt hơn để trả về: true / false hoặc hàng bị ảnh hưởng?
Tôi có một số phương thức thực hiện một số thay đổi dữ liệu trong cơ sở dữ liệu (chèn, cập nhật và xóa). Các ORM Tôi đang sử dụng giá trị int trở lại hàng bị ảnh hưởng đối với những loại phương pháp. Tôi nên trả lại cái …

3
Danh sách tham số của phương thức có nên chứa các đối tượng hoặc định danh đối tượng không?
Các đội của chúng tôi đang có cuộc thảo luận sau: Giả sử chúng ta có hai phương pháp sau: public Response Withdraw(int clubId, int terminalId,int cardId, string invoice, decimal amount); public Response Withdraw(Club club, Terminal terminal,Card card, string invoice, decimal amount); những gì được gửi qua mạng chỉ là …
10 design  methods 

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.